Track Opens Spring Season with Snowflake Classic
April 07, 2000 | Men's Track & Field
April 7, 2000
The men's track team opened their outdoor season at the Snowflake Classic, hosted by Tufts University on Saturday, April 1 in Medford. Eagle athletes won four events and had 11 other top-five finishes.
Juniors Dan Fitzgerald, Justin Burdon and Jeff Normant won the 800-meters, 1500-meters and 400-meter low hurdles, respectively, while freshman Brad Chun took top honors in the pole vault.
Fitzgerald's 1:57 led a group of five Eagle runners in the top seven. Mike McKenzie, Mike Krashes, James Mann and Brian Shafer followed Fitzgerald in fourth through seventh place.
Boston College also placed four runners in the top five behind Burdon. Shafer ran to a second-place finish while Vernon Mickle and Brian Mahoney were fourth and fifth.
In the 400-meter hurdles, Normant won with a 54:71 and was followed in third by Erik DeMarco.
Other top scorers came from Pete Vaglio (third - 400-meters), Bennett Valencia (fifth - 400-meters), Matt Ramsey (third - 110-meter high hurdles), Jason Pink (third - pole vault), and Gabe Verdaguer (fifth - pole vault, fourth - long jump).
The men's track team will next compete at the Connecticut Invitational on April 8 in Storrs, Conn. Selected athletes will travel to Durham, N.C. to participate in the annual Duke Relays on April 7-8.
